Job description

Role overview

La Glem Mineral Consultancy is recruiting a Geologist to strengthen its technical team in Kampala. The firm operates as an independent advisor in geology, mining, and mineral investment, supporting mining businesses, investors, banks and other financial institutions, mineral processors, and public-sector bodies across Uganda and the wider East African region.

The position is suited to a professional who is keen on mineral exploration, mining projects, and delivering dependable technical outputs. The selected candidate will contribute to fieldwork, project assessments, due diligence, and advisory assignments related to mineral assets and investment decisions.

Core duties

The role involves geological mapping, site-based investigations, and mineral prospecting work. You will also help plan and oversee exploration campaigns, including sampling, trenching, and drilling operations.

In addition, you will analyse geological, geochemical, and geophysical information; produce maps, cross-sections, and technical documentation; and contribute to mineral resource reviews and mining due diligence studies.

Further duties include inspecting mine sites, verifying project details, supporting licence reviews, checking regulatory compliance, and working with cross-functional teams on exploration, mining, and investment-related assignments.

Candidate profile

The ideal applicant holds a Bachelor’s Degree in Geology, Applied Geology, Earth Sciences, or a closely related discipline. A minimum of 3 years of professional experience in mineral exploration, mining geology, or geological consulting is required.

Experience involving gold, tin, coltan, rare earth elements, or industrial minerals will be an advantage. Strong working knowledge of GIS tools such as ArcGIS or QGIS, together with Microsoft Office, is expected.

Applicants should also have solid analytical ability, strong technical report-writing skills, and a readiness to travel frequently to project locations in Uganda and across the East African region.
